MMA Prosper Wise retirement planning tool |
Not sure if you’re on track for retirement or where to start? With MMA Prosper Wise, you have access to one-on-one financial coaching at no cost. A financial coach can help you build a plan, understand your options, and make confident decisions, whether you’re focused on retirement, budgeting, or saving for what’s next. Members of your household can also use this benefit. Learn more here and follow the instructions to create your account.

Experience Rochester talk on GLP-1 medications |
URochester Medicine experts Susanne Miedlich and Adnin Zaman will unpack the biology, clinical applications, and future potential of GLP-1–based therapies in this free talk on Thursday, June 25, from noon to 1 p.m.

Do aliens exist? I asked an astrophysicist. |
The Washington Post, June 10
On the Reasonably Optimistic podcast, Adam Frank, the Helen F. and Fred H. Gowen Professor in the Department of Physics and Astronomy, talks about the search for alien life and the limits of what UFO disclosures can reveal.

Christine Donnelly, Administrative Coordinator |
Each week, we spotlight a faculty or staff member who has been recognized as a UR Star. Christine Donnelly, an administrative coordinator in the Department of Health Humanities and Bioethics, was recognized for demonstrating excellence.
“I want to sincerely thank and show my appreciation to Chris. As I have taken on the Ethics Liaison Program, Chris has graciously held my hand along the way, helping me with all the nitty-gritty work of obtaining CNE/CME credit, room reservation, agenda planning, presenter forms, program evaluation, and more. We would be lost without her. Her attention to detail is critical, and has caught my errors on many occasions, in addition to her adherence to a deadline; I don’t know how she keeps it all straight. Chris, you are so important, and I value your work ethic and willingness to help. Thank you!”
